Information Rights Management (IRM) Service Delivery Lead
Role Definition:
Caterpillar must ensure market differentiating intellectual property is appropriately secured with an optimized security posture and our Cybersecurity Team is seeking a Cybersecurity Analyst to join our Data Protection team. In this role you will have the opportunity to use analytics and automation to help protect against cybersecurity threats. You will be part of a dynamic team, working and interacting with other groups across Cybersecurity and Enterprise IT.
The person who fills this position will be responsible for overseeing, coordinating, and driving all technical aspects of Caterpillar’s Digital Rights Management (DRM) solutions. They will be expected to work with internal process partners to ensure DRM meets their various use cases and work with solution vendors to resolve technical issues in a timely manner.
Process automation skills are an essential aspect of this role. The incumbent must be an expert in using process automation technologies and languages to interconnect systems and automate otherwise manual processes. Upward advancement opportunities are available for an incumbent who requires minimal work direction and demonstrates a significant amount of initiative, accountability, ability to innovate, and is business savvy. The incumbent will also regularly present to senior leadership regarding the affairs and improvement opportunities within their scope of responsibilities
What You Will Do:
+ Serve as enterprise subject matter expert for DRM within Caterpillar
+ Work with internal process partners to ensure Caterpillar’s enterprise DRM solutions are technically optimized and function as intended.
+ Collaborate with internal Caterpillar process partners to implement new DRM related use cases.
+ Work with Cybersecurity leadership to optimize the value Caterpillar is receiving from its DRM-related investments.
+ Partner with team members to improve Caterpillar’s security posture and provide mentoring to junior team members.
+ Build and evaluate DRM policies within Microsoft Information Protection (MIP).
+ Perform use case testing with DRM solutions, such as MIP.
+ Perform case migrations between multiple DRM solutions.

About Caterpillar -
Caterpillar Inc. is the world’s leading manufacturer of construction and mining equipment, off-highway diesel and natural gas engines, industrial gas turbines and diesel-electric locomotives. For nearly 100 years, we’ve been helping customers build a better, more sustainable world and are committed and contributing to a reduced-carbon future. Our innovative products and services, backed by our global dealer network, provide exceptional value that helps customers succeed.
